    Mtn Bikers - Diamondback??

    To disable ads, please log-in.

    Question for the Mtn Bikers. Are Diamondback bikes - Sorrento or Outlook any good for an entry level bike to ride the single tracks, 2 tracks, bike paths? I was also thinking about a Trek 3700. I want to get something to take camping, ride some of the local trails - nothing rough. Any recommendations? I don't want to spend more about $350. Thanks

    Generally, anything under $400 is for leisurely riding - not real mountain bike riding. The quality of the components will not stand up to the pounding of mtn riding. The DB Sorrento or Outlook should work for a gravel path or light off road trail.
